Job Title : Oracle DBA
Location : Albany, NY
Duration : 12 Months
Interview : Phone & In-person
Job Description:
Description of Duties and Responsibilities
The duties and responsibilities of the DBA will include, but are not limited to, the following:
• Provide database administration expertise in the Oracle 11g and 12c environments;
• Assist with design, support and maintenance of 100+ Oracle Database Management systems;
• Maintain, develop, and implement policies and procedures for ensuring the security and integrity of several databases;
• Resolve Oracle database performance issues, database capacity issues, replication, and other distributed data issues; and
• Install and implement ASM and Transparent Data Encryption.
Minimum Qualifications
Over seven (7+) years of experience in Oracle Database Administration, including production support, installation, configuration, upgrades, patches, migration, backup and recovery, performance tuning, and cloning. Over three (3+) years of experience must be on Oracle 11G or above. This experience must include:
• Experience in installation, configuration and administration of Oracle 11g or above RAC in UNIX operating system environment;
• Experience in installation, configuration and administration of Oracle 11g or above Data Guard configuration, implementation and maintenance of Standby Databases;
• Proficient skills managing Automatic Storage Manager (ASM);
• Experience in installation, configuration and maintenance (upgrades and patching) of Oracle Enterprise Manager (OEM12c)
• Experience administering Oracle Enterprise Manager (OEM) to perform daily tasks of monitoring, performance tuning and maintenance of the enterprise databases;
• Experience in installation, configuration of Transparent Data Encryption (TDE);
• Expertise in developing Oracle Backup and Recovery strategy and scripts using RMAN;
• Experience analyzing job performance and tuning SQLs;
• Experience performing database tuning utilizing SQL Tuning advisor, AWR statistics, OEM, explain plan;
• Experience writing Unix Kornshell scripts to automate database operation;
• Experience with implementation of Oracle partitioning;
• Experience with Oracle Automatic Memory Management (AMM);
• Ability to develop technical documentation and provide knowledge transfer as needed by OSC management;
• Ability to act as a resource to answer technical questions and/or provide guidance to OSC staff as it relates to Oracle database administration best practices; and
• Experience working with Oracle Support to report and resolve issues/bugs.
